I just had my surgery last week, I was pretty much un-effected emotionally until the day of my surgery when I realized everything was gonna change. I've always been overweight and have always had to put up these walls to protect my feelings and dreams from being crushed, but now I feel like they could possibly be set free. It's weird and I just wanted to know if anyone else feels similar

Ever been held back from something because of your weight?

Think of this as a second chance?

Yep I had the same thing. I have been banded about 7 mos and haven't been really emotionally affected much, but I have come to realize the things I covered up or compensated for because I was over weight and unhappy about it. For example-I was a huge purse-aholic. I bought a new Jessica Simpson bag probably every month. I also tanned like it was my job. I have noticed now that I've lost weight I haven't had the urge to run to Dillards and get a new purse, and haven't set foot in a tanning bed. I realized I was doing it to compensate for how unhappy I was with the way I looked & thought maybe tanning and a new bag would help. It didn't. You will find your own things you realized you did and it traces back to weight. Its different for sure with everyone but I think if nothing else you will realize how much happier you are going to become. You will have your days thats up and down but overall you should be very proud of yourself at the end of the day, this is a big step and a very honorable thing to do for youself.
